As a trauma informed, Certified Yoga Therapist { C-IAYT } my approach unites advanced training in the therapeutic, technical and spiritual applications of yoga, with an in-depth knowledge of anatomy, patho-physiology, movement rehabilitation, trauma theory, family systems theory, attachment theory and somatic & transpersonal psychology. As a yoga practitioner I teach and practice in the spirit of Tantra; yoga as an embodied art form, a holistic, ever-evolving practice for living, and a powerful, therapeutic tool for deepening our embodied self-awareness and achieving greater alignment on all levels. Tending The Heart :: Practices for Physiological & Emotional Regulation

According to the heart coherence is "the state when the heart, mind and emotions are in energetic alignment and cooperation." Heart coherence is key to our overall health and optimal functioning. When the heart and mind are in coherence, β€œthe regulation of life processes become efficient, free-flowing and easy".

Similarly, in yoga and Ayurveda, the heart is considered the original seat of consciousness, a crucial energetic hub in the body where many physical and energetic pathways intersect. The heart is the convergence between our inner and outer worlds. Ojas (our most subtle essence of vitality and immunity) resides in the heart and can be negatively impacted by stress, trauma, lifestyle, the quality of our relationships and our state of consciousness.
